Underwater Welder salary in Congo

Average Yearly Salary of Underwater Welder in Congo is approximately 7,615,896 CDF (3,102 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Underwater Welder do?

occupation personasAn underwater welder is a highly skilled professional who performs welding tasks in underwater environments. This occupation requires a unique set of skills and qualifications, combining expertise in both welding techniques and diving procedures. Underwater welders are primarily responsible for repairing and maintaining structures such as oil rigs, pipelines, ships, and bridges that are submerged in water. They use specialized equipment, including dry and wet welding techniques, to join metal components and ensure the integrity and safety of underwater structures. The occupation of an underwater welder demands physical fitness, excellent diving skills, and comprehensive knowledge of welding procedures. It also requires the ability to work under challenging conditions, including low visibility, high pressure, and extreme temperatures. Safety precautions and adherence to strict guidelines are crucial aspects of this job. The work can be physically demanding and hazardous, making it essential for underwater welders to have proper training and certification.
